1. Zermatt

The Matterhorn is visible from this beautiful alpine village, making it one of the best honeymoon places in Switzerland.

Photo: Andrew Bossi / Wikimedia Commons

Zermatt is a dreamy alpine village at the foot of the Matterhorn. The town is car-free, making it peaceful and perfect for couples. Luxury chalets, fine dining, and breathtaking mountain views make it one of the best honeymoon places in Switzerland. Couples can enjoy skiing in winter, scenic train rides, and romantic hikes. The Glacier Paradise offers panoramic views, while the Gornergrat Railway provides an unforgettable experience. Whether you prefer adventure or relaxation, Zermatt has something for everyone.

Best Time To Visit: June to September for hiking, December to March for skiing
Must Have Experiences: Ride the Gornergrat Railway, take a helicopter tour, ski in winter, and enjoy a candlelight dinner at a mountain top restaurant
Ideal Trip Duration: 2 – 3 days

2. Interlaken

Interlaken is famous for its adventure, luxurious hotels, and stunning views, making it one of the best honeymoon places in Switzerland.

Photo: Julian Ryf / Wikimedia Commons

Interlaken is a picturesque town between Lake Thun and Lake Brienz. It offers breathtaking views, luxury hotels, and adventure activities. It is one of the best honeymoon places in Switzerland for couples who love adventure. Paragliding over the lakes, taking scenic train rides, and enjoying cosy lakeside cafés are some must-do experiences. The town is also the gateway to the Jungfraujoch, Europe’s highest railway station. With endless outdoor activities, Interlaken guarantees an unforgettable honeymoon experience.

Best Time To Visit: Year – round, with winter offering a magical snowy experience
Must Have Experiences: Paragliding over the lakes, a train ride to Jungfraujoch, a scenic cruise, and dining at Harder Kulm
Ideal Trip Duration: 3 – 4 days

6. Ticino

The countryside boasts a warm climate, stunning nature views, and a relaxed environment.

Photo: Adrian Michael / Wikimedia Commons

Ticino, Switzerland’s Italian-speaking region, offers a Mediterranean charm. Palm-lined lakes, vibrant markets, and romantic waterfronts make it one of the top places to visit in Switzerland for honeymoon. Bellinzona’s castles offer a glimpse into history, while the stunning Verzasca Valley is perfect for scenic hikes. Couples can enjoy lakeside strolls in Lugano, savour authentic Italian cuisine, or take a scenic boat ride. Ticino’s warm climate and relaxed vibe make it a great honeymoon destination.

Best Time To Visit: Spring and summer for pleasant weather
Must Have Experiences: Explore Bellinzona’s castles, visit the Verzasca Valley, and enjoy a lakeside dinner in Lugano
Ideal Trip Duration: 3 days

9. Montreux

Situated by Lake Geneva, Montreux is known for its beautiful scenery, jazz music, and lakeside promenade.

Photo: Jérémy Toma / Wikimedia Commons

Montreux, located on the shores of Lake Geneva, is famous for its jazz music, stunning scenery, and charming lakeside promenades. The town offers a relaxing yet vibrant atmosphere, making it one of the best honeymoon places in Switzerland. Couples can visit the famous Château de Chillon, explore the Lavaux Vineyards, or take a scenic ride on the GoldenPass train. The stunning lake views, romantic restaurants, and cultural charm make Montreux a perfect honeymoon destination.

Best Time To Visit: Year – round, with summer perfect for outdoor activities
Must Have Experiences: Walk along the lakeside promenade, explore the Lavaux Vineyards, and take a ride on the GoldenPass train
Ideal Trip Duration: 2 – 3 days
